首页
/ 社交媒体历史记录完整备份方案:GetQzonehistory高效导出工具使用指南

社交媒体历史记录完整备份方案:GetQzonehistory高效导出工具使用指南

2026-04-29 11:15:18作者:傅爽业Veleda

GetQzonehistory是一款专为QQ空间用户设计的社交媒体数据备份工具,能够完整导出个人历史说说、转发内容、留言记录及相关图片,为用户提供安全可靠的本地数据存档解决方案。通过简洁的操作流程和强大的数据处理能力,帮助用户轻松实现重要社交数据的备份与管理。

工具概述:社交媒体数据备份的理想选择

在数字时代,个人社交媒体数据的价值日益凸显。GetQzonehistory作为一款专注于QQ空间数据备份的工具,致力于解决用户对历史内容存档的核心需求。无论是为了保存珍贵回忆、满足数据管理需求,还是出于内容迁移的目的,这款工具都能提供全面的解决方案。

该工具采用Python开发,具备跨平台特性,支持Windows、macOS和Linux系统,能够深度解析QQ空间数据结构,实现高效、完整的数据提取与本地存储。

核心能力:全方位数据备份解决方案

GetQzonehistory提供以下关键功能,满足用户对社交媒体数据备份的多样化需求:

  • 完整数据采集:全面获取用户发布的说说、转发内容、留言记录等互动数据
  • 媒体资源保存:自动下载说说中的图片资源,确保内容完整性
  • 多格式数据导出:支持Excel表格和HTML网页两种输出格式,兼顾数据分析与视觉浏览
  • 好友信息备份:同步导出QQ好友列表及相关信息,完善社交关系存档
  • 智能分类整理:自动对不同类型内容进行分类,提高数据管理效率

环境配置:快速搭建备份工作环境

系统要求

  • Python 3.6及以上版本
  • 稳定的网络连接
  • 至少100MB可用存储空间(根据备份内容量可能需要更多)

安装步骤

# 克隆项目仓库
git clone https://gitcode.com/GitHub_Trending/ge/GetQzonehistory
cd GetQzonehistory

# 创建并激活虚拟环境
python -m venv myenv
source myenv/bin/activate  # Linux/macOS系统
# .\myenv\Scripts\activate  # Windows系统

# 安装依赖包
pip install -r requirements.txt

操作指南:三步完成社交媒体数据备份

1. 启动程序

在终端中执行以下命令启动工具:

python main.py

2. 身份验证

程序启动后将显示二维码,使用手机QQ扫描二维码并确认登录,完成身份验证过程。

3. 数据备份与查看

  • 登录成功后,工具将自动开始数据采集过程
  • 进度信息将实时显示在终端界面
  • 备份完成后,程序将自动打开结果文件夹

功能解析:核心模块工作原理

GetQzonehistory采用模块化设计,各核心模块协同工作实现完整的数据备份流程:

  • 登录认证模块 (util/LoginUtil.py):通过模拟网页登录流程,实现安全的身份验证
  • 配置管理模块 (util/ConfigUtil.py):处理程序配置参数,优化数据采集策略
  • 网络请求模块 (util/RequestUtil.py):发送网络请求获取QQ空间数据,处理请求异常
  • 数据解析模块 (fetch_all_message.py):解析原始数据,提取有价值的信息
  • 工具函数集合 (util/ToolsUtil.py):提供数据格式化、文件处理等辅助功能

成果展示:备份文件结构与内容

备份完成后,在项目的resource/result目录下将生成以下文件和文件夹:

  • 数据表格文件

    • QQ号_全部列表.xlsx:包含所有类型内容的完整数据
    • QQ号_说说列表.xlsx:仅包含原创说说内容
    • QQ号_转发列表.xlsx:转发内容的单独表格
    • QQ号_留言列表.xlsx:互动留言记录
    • QQ号_好友列表.xlsx:好友信息存档
  • 媒体文件

    • pic/:存储所有下载的图片资源
  • 网页版展示

    • QQ号_说说网页版.html:模拟QQ空间界面的网页文件

安全提示:数据备份的注意事项

使用GetQzonehistory进行社交媒体数据备份时,请遵守以下安全准则:

  • 隐私保护:备份文件包含个人敏感信息,请妥善保管,避免泄露
  • 使用范围:仅用于备份个人账号数据,不得用于未经授权的信息采集
  • 账号安全:确保在安全环境下使用,避免在公共设备上进行登录操作
  • 法律合规:遵守相关法律法规,尊重他人隐私权和知识产权
  • 数据更新:定期进行数据备份,以保持数据的最新状态

高级应用:定制化数据备份方案

对于有技术背景的用户,GetQzonehistory提供了灵活的定制化选项:

  • 修改采集参数:通过编辑main.py调整数据采集的时间范围和内容类型
  • 自定义输出格式:修改util/ToolsUtil.py中的数据处理函数,实现个性化的文件格式
  • 扩展功能开发:基于现有模块架构,添加新的数据处理或导出功能
  • 自动化备份:结合系统定时任务功能,实现定期自动备份

GetQzonehistory为社交媒体数据备份提供了可靠、高效的解决方案,无论是普通用户还是技术爱好者,都能通过这款工具轻松实现QQ空间历史数据的完整保存与管理。通过本地备份,用户可以更好地掌控自己的数字资产,确保珍贵回忆和重要数据不会因平台变化而丢失。

登录后查看全文
热门项目推荐
相关项目推荐